ASC2018: Adisak’s dramatic penalty miss sends Malaysia into final

2018, Latest News, ThailandBy Editor AFFDecember 5, 2018

BANGKOK (5 Dec 2018) – Thai striker Adisak Kraisorn’s missed penalty in the dying moments of the AFF Suzuki Cup second-leg semi-final battle saw Malaysia advance on the away goals at the expense of defending champions Thailand at the Rajamangala Stadium here tonight. Thailand, five-time champions, snatched the lead twice but Malaysia recovered to secure a…
